Handover note — Crumbwheel order cutoffs.

Welcome aboard. The bakery cutoff rule in Crumbwheel closes same-day orders at 14:00 local to each storefront, not UTC — this has bitten us twice. Holiday overrides live in the calendar service and take precedence silently, so always check there first when a cutoff looks wrong. To unlock the calendar service's admin console after a restart, enter the recovery passphrase below.

vault phrase of bagap-bahaf = silion-pelox-sorox-casdor-quenwyn-fraax-eliox-praael-kelion-quenvan-kasox-rusael-norius-belvan

**Finance Review Summary: Brindlewood JV Proposal**

Quick read for department heads: the proposed joint venture with Okari Systems looks workable. We'd hold 55%, contribute the Fennick platform and working capital; they bring distribution across the eastern corridor. Modeled payback is under three years, even on conservative volumes. Main risks are integration costs and their legacy licensing tangle. Legal review kicks off next week. Strategic context sits in the note below.

board note of kageg-bahof: The renewal with Holwynax Holdings closes at $2 million a year, 5 percent below the last contract. Project Ulaath slips by two quarters because of the supplier delay.

**CI note: websocket reconnect flake (plugin authors, read this)**

If your Lanternbay plugin tests fail with "reconnect storm" errors, it's not you — our CI harness drops the socket once per run to test backoff, and some older SDK shims retry too aggressively. Pin your shim to v3 or newer. To help us correlate failures, quote the harness token printed under the next line.

session token of tajog-fahaf = htk21_4ae55819f45410afcb307

v3.8.0 — Renamed AGENT_SKEW_LIMIT to BUILD_CLOCK_SKEW_MAX_MS to clarify units after repeated confusion on the Driftgate build farm. Agents exceeding the limit are now quarantined rather than silently rescheduled. The old name is still read with a deprecation warning until v4.0. Update agent env files accordingly. The skew reporter also now authenticates to the coordinator; add the following line beneath the renamed setting:

env line for fafof-fahag: LEDGER_TOKEN5=f8790